Get Vomit Out of ASAP!

If you leave the vomit on the carpet for too long, it will seek further into the fibres of the carpet and maybe even the padding underneath. This is the nightmare that you would want to avoid. Because if this happens, it might be difficult to get rid of the obnoxious odour. It will leave you no choice but to e get rid of the carpet.

Most Effective Way to Get Vomit Out of the Carpet

  • Absorbent granules are another easy but effective approach to clean up dog vomit. Simply sprinkle them over the vomit mess and wait a few minutes for them to dry. After that, vacuum up the granules that have transformed the vomit into powder.

That’s an easy-peasy lemon squeeze, right; it would leave you away from making an effort through gloves to remove the vomit. The absorbent granules are colour-safe, so you can use these without the worry about carpet staining.

Carpet Cleaning Melbourne

  • The granules may not leave the stain on the carpet, but the vomit might have, so now it is time to pour white vinegar, hydroxide solution or alcohol solution over the strain. To remove the stain, dampen a cloth with the following solution and use it into the spot to remove as much of the stain as possible.
  • Sprinkle a generous amount of baking soda over the area of the vomit, and it is time to patiently wait for a day to let the baking soda soak in all the bad stench caused by the vomit. Baking soda’s natural absorbency will absorb the liquid portion of the pet vomit stain that might have been left after using the solution to remove the stain.
